Output 64cadb8963f4379699b65921a874562eef824e7fe557c4b36a2ab9b4db51f191:7

value
492755768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3e863d0ed9bfc921bb8de1c6acef23e44e18abe OP_EQUAL
address
3J6HGcdkiG1cjH98X9uj8dVNjAjHDaBQW3
transaction
64cadb8963f4379699b65921a874562eef824e7fe557c4b36a2ab9b4db51f191
confirmations
326941
spent
true